there are 7 life processes, and they are : movement,respiration,sensitivity,growth,reproduction,excretion, and nutrition.

you can remember them easily by the word, MRS GREN.

1 - characteristics that remain in the common ancestor and the modern organism

2 - characteristics that are new and have been modified from what was found in the common ancestor

If a characteristic is found in all of the members of a group, it

is a shared ancestral character because there has been no

change in the trait during the descent of each of the members

of the clade. Although these traits appear interesting because

they unify the clade, in cladistics they are considered not

helpful when we are trying to determine the relationships of the

members of the clade because every member is the same.
